Default RE: Stuff that makes bowhunting, bowhunting!

Amen to that Steve.

Countless times I can recall the " failures" that in reality are successes because we come away from the experience with education, knowledge and maturity in bowhunting.

If it wasn' t for the failures, the success' s wouldn' t be great.

And I' m a man of steel when I come to full draw...I' ve done it thousands of times through practice, 3D competitions and tournaments....but you should see the out of breath, giggling little kid in me when the arrow leaves the bow....or at times, the white ghosted teary eyed zombie if the arrow doesn' t....[]
